Industrialist. Soon after the Civil War, Fordyce established the bank Fordyce & Rison in Huntsville, Alabama. Ten year later, he got involved with the railroads. He helped reorganized the St. Louis Southwestern Railway Company in 1885 & was named its president. He is credited with constructing over 24,000 miles of railroad tracks throughout Missouri & Arkansas. He became director of the St. Louis Union Trust Company & founded one of the largest health resorts in Hot Springs, Arkansas. Good friends with Presidents McKinley & Grant, Fordyce became active in Democratic politics in Arkansas & Alabama.
